The course Computational Biological Chemistry-Q254 of the Bachelor’s degree in Chemistry at the Faculty of Science of the University of Porto is fundamental for the academic training of the student. The implementation of this course is taken here as a case study in scientific training in chemistry. The learning outcomes motivate also reflections on the current role of the university tutor in the formation of the students as future scientists.
